Remove LiveKit integration from chat.tsx
- Remove all LiveKit imports (registerGlobals, LiveKitRoom, useVoiceAssistant, etc.) - Remove VoiceCallTranscriptHandler component - Remove voice call state management (callState, isCallActive) - Remove voice call functions (startVoiceCall, endVoiceCall, handleVoiceTranscript) - Remove LiveKitRoom component from JSX - Remove debug panel for voice calls - Clean up unused imports (Clipboard, Animated, expo-keep-awake, useAuth, useVoiceTranscript, useVoiceCall) - Remove unused styles (voiceButton, callActiveIndicator, debug panel styles) - Update initial message text to remove voice call references 🤖 Generated with [Claude Code](https://claude.com/claude-code) Co-Authored-By: Claude <noreply@anthropic.com>
